A growing interest among people in MK Ultra is spurred by recent discussions surrounding the covert program's controversial history. A blog summarizing key points from Kinzerโs book has shocked many and opened up new conversations about government experiments in mind control.
Reports suggest that the MK Ultra program, orchestrated by the CIA during the Cold War, sought to explore mind control through drugs and psychological manipulation. This disturbing chapter in U.S. history resurfaces as people delve into the book by Kinzer, revealing unsettling truths.
